MMESAE is a term that refers to a specific type of software or system used in the field of computer science and information technology. The acronym stands for "Multi-Modal Emotion Sensing and Analysis Engine." This system is designed to detect, analyze, and interpret human emotions through various modalities, such as facial expressions, voice tone, and body language. MMESAE utilizes advanced algorithms and machine learning techniques to process and understand these inputs, providing valuable insights into emotional states.
